Incident Overview
A 37-year-old man has died and another man is seriously injured after the ute they were traveling in collided with a truck on the Hume Motorway in Ingleburn, southwest of Sydney. The incident occurred on Wednesday night, November 13, 2024.
Location and Time
The crash happened around 10:30 pm on the Hume Motorway at Ingleburn, southwest of Sydney.
Vehicles Involved
The crash involved two vehicles: a ute and a truck.
Crash Description
A ute and a truck collided on the Hume Motorway. The circumstances leading to the crash are under investigation.
Injuries/Fatalities
The 37-year-old male passenger of the ute died in the hospital after being transported from the scene. The 47-year-old male driver of the ute was trapped in the vehicle before being freed and taken to the hospital in serious condition. The 36-year-old truck driver was not injured.
Emergency Response
Emergency services attended the scene, including police, paramedics, and possibly a rescue crew to free the trapped ute driver.
Investigation
Police are investigating the circumstances surrounding the crash with the assistance of specialist officers from the Crash Investigation Unit. A report will be prepared for the coroner.
